Background
The World Food Programme is an international organization within the United Nations that provides food assistance worldwide. It is the world’s largest humanitarian organization and the leading provider of school meals. Founded in 1961. Assisting 80 million people in around 80 countries each year, the World Food Programme (WFP) delivering food assistance in emergencies and working with communities to improve nutrition and build resilience
